(2025年)《微机原理及应用》试卷及其答案_第1页
(2025年)《微机原理及应用》试卷及其答案_第2页
(2025年)《微机原理及应用》试卷及其答案_第3页
(2025年)《微机原理及应用》试卷及其答案_第4页
(2025年)《微机原理及应用》试卷及其答案_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

(2025年)《微机原理及应用》试卷及其答案一、单项选择题(每小题2分,共20分)1.以下不属于8086CPU内部功能部件的是()A.执行单元EUB.总线接口单元BIUC.算术逻辑单元ALUD.内存控制器2.某指令的操作数采用寄存器间接寻址,若指令中给出的寄存器是BX,则操作数的物理地址计算方式为()A.DS×16+BXB.ES×16+BXC.SS×16+BXD.CS×16+BX3.8086CPU在最小模式下执行写内存操作时,控制信号M/IO、WR的状态分别为()A.0、0B.0、1C.1、0D.1、14.若某微机系统的总线周期由4个T状态组成,其中T3状态结束后检测到READY=0,则CPU会在()插入等待状态Tw。A.T1之后B.T2之后C.T3之后D.T4之后5.以下关于中断响应的描述,错误的是()A.CPU需在指令周期结束时检测中断请求B.可屏蔽中断INTR需IF=1才会响应C.非屏蔽中断NMI的优先级高于INTRD.中断响应时CPU自动保护所有寄存器内容6.8086的标志寄存器FLAGS中,用于表示无符号数运算溢出的标志位是()A.OFB.CFC.ZFD.SF7.若某存储芯片的地址线为12根,数据线为8根,则该芯片的存储容量为()A.1KBB.4KBC.8KBD.16KB8.以下关于I/O端口独立编址的特点,正确的是()A.端口地址与内存地址统一编排B.需专用的I/O指令(如IN/OUT)C.访问端口使用MOV指令D.端口地址空间受限于内存地址范围9.某A/D转换器的分辨率为12位,参考电压为5V,则其最小量化单位约为()A.1.22mVB.2.44mVC.4.88mVD.9.76mV10.以下汇编指令中,会改变标志寄存器内容的是()A.MOVAX,BXB.XCHGAX,BXC.ADDAX,BXD.LEAAX,[BX]二、填空题(每空2分,共20分)1.8086CPU的地址总线有______根,可寻址的最大内存空间为______。2.总线周期是指CPU完成一次______或______操作所需的时间。3.若SP=0100H,执行PUSHAX后,SP的值变为______;若再执行POPBX,则SP的值变为______。4.动态RAM(DRAM)需要定期刷新的原因是______,常用的刷新方式包括______和分散刷新。5.中断向量表的起始地址为______,每个中断向量占______个字节。三、简答题(每小题6分,共36分)1.简述冯诺依曼计算机的基本结构及各部分功能。2.说明8086CPU最小模式与最大模式的主要区别。3.比较MOV指令与XCHG指令的功能差异,并举例说明。4.为什么动态RAM需要刷新?刷新与读/写操作有何不同?5.简述中断处理的基本流程(从外设发出中断请求到返回断点)。6.CPU与I/O接口之间通常需要传递哪几类信息?各自的作用是什么?四、分析题(每小题8分,共16分)1.已知8086CPU中,DS=2000H,BX=0100H,SI=0002H,内存单元[20102H]=34H,[20103H]=12H,[20104H]=56H,[20105H]=78H。执行指令“MOVAX,[BX+SI]”后,AX的内容是什么?若该指令改为“LEAAX,[BX+SI]”,则AX的内容又是什么?2.某微机系统使用74LS138译码器(3-8译码器)设计内存扩展电路,其中A15~A13作为译码器输入(A15为最高位),译码器输出Y0连接某存储芯片的片选端。已知CPU地址总线为A19~A0(A19为最高位),未参与译码的地址线A12~A0全部接0。试计算该存储芯片的地址范围(用十六进制表示)。五、设计题(8分)某系统需要用8255A并行接口芯片设计一个4×4矩阵键盘接口,要求:(1)确定8255A的工作方式;(2)画出端口连接示意图(只需标注关键信号);(3)编写8255A的初始化程序(假设控制端口地址为0FFFEH);(4)简述键盘扫描子程序的基本流程。答案一、单项选择题1.D2.A3.C4.C5.D6.B7.C(2^12×8bit=4096×1B=4KB?更正:12根地址线对应2^12=4096个单元,每个单元8位即1字节,故容量为4KB,选项B?原题可能笔误,正确应为4KB,选B。但原设计需检查。假设题目正确,可能用户需求为原创,故按原题选项,此处可能设置为8KB,需调整。实际正确计算:12根地址线→2^12=4096个地址,8位数据线→每个地址1字节,故4096B=4KB,正确选项为B。原第7题选项B为4KB,故答案应为B。可能原题设置错误,需修正。)(注:根据严格计算,第7题正确答案为B,4KB。原选项可能笔误,此处以正确答案为准。)更正后答案:7.B其余答案:1.D2.A3.C4.C5.D6.B7.B8.B9.A(5V/4096≈1.22mV)10.C二、填空题1.20;1MB(2^20B)2.内存访问;I/O访问(或读/写内存;读/写I/O)3.00FEH;0100H4.存储电荷的电容会漏电导致信息丢失;集中刷新5.00000H;4三、简答题1.冯诺依曼结构包括运算器、控制器、存储器、输入设备、输出设备。运算器完成算术/逻辑运算;控制器协调各部件工作;存储器存储程序和数据;输入设备将外部信息转换为计算机能处理的形式;输出设备将处理结果转换为外部可识别的形式。2.最小模式由CPU单独控制总线,用于单处理器系统,控制信号直接由CPU引脚输出(如M/IO、WR、ALE等);最大模式需总线控制器(如8288)协助提供控制信号,支持多处理器系统,CPU通过S2~S0状态信号经8288译码后产生总线控制信号。3.MOV指令将源操作数复制到目的操作数,不改变源操作数(如MOVAX,BX将BX内容复制到AX);XCHG指令交换两个操作数的内容(如XCHGAX,BX后AX和BX内容互换)。MOV可用于寄存器、内存、立即数之间的数据传递,XCHG仅支持寄存器与寄存器、寄存器与内存之间的交换,且不能包含立即数。4.DRAM以电容存储电荷表示数据,电容存在漏电现象,电荷会逐渐丢失,因此需定期刷新(通常每2ms刷新一次)。刷新是对所有存储单元逐行读取并重写,仅恢复电荷;读/写操作是对特定单元的访问,会改变单元内容(写操作)或仅读取(读操作)。5.流程:①外设通过中断请求线向CPU发中断请求;②CPU在指令周期结束且允许中断(IF=1)时响应;③CPU关中断(清IF),保护断点(CS、IP、FLAGS入栈);④根据中断类型号查找中断向量表,获取中断服务程序入口地址;⑤跳转到中断服务程序执行;⑥执行完毕后恢复断点(IP、CS、FLAGS出栈),开中断(置IF=1),返回原程序。6.三类信息:①数据信息(包括数字量、模拟量、开关量),是CPU与外设交换的实际内容;②状态信息(如外设“准备好”“忙”标志),用于CPU判断外设工作状态;③控制信息(如外设启动/停止命令),用于CPU控制外设动作。四、分析题1.物理地址=DS×16+BX+SI=20000H+0100H+0002H=20102H。内存中[20102H]=34H(低字节),[20103H]=12H(高字节),故AX=1234H(小端模式)。若为LEA指令(取有效地址),则AX=BX+SI=0100H+0002H=0102H。2.74LS138译码器输入A15~A13(Y0对应输入000),故A15=0,A14=0,A13=0。未参与译码的A19~A16(假设系统为20位地址线,A19~A0)默认接0(题目中未参与译码的A12~A0接0,可能A19~A16也未说明,需明确。若系统地址线为A19~A0,且仅A15~A13参与译码,其余高位(A19~A16)未连接,通常默认接地(0),则高位全0。地址范围计算:A19~A16=0000,A15~A13=000(Y0有效),A12~A0=000000000000(全0)→最小地址:00000000000000000000B=00000H;A19~A16=0000,A15~A13=000,A12~A0=111111111111(全1)→最大地址:00000000000011111111B=000FFH。因此,地址范围为00000H~000FFH。五、设计题(1)8255A工作于方式0:A口作为行线(输出),B口作为列线(输入),C口未使用(或任意)。(2)端口连接:A口(PA0~PA3)接键盘行线(R0~R3),B口(PB0~PB3)接键盘列线(C0~C3);RESET接系统复位信号,D0~D7接数据总线,CS接译码器输出(如Y1),A1、A0接地址线A1、A0(控制端口地址0FFFEH,故A1=1,A0=0,即端口地址:A口0FFFCH,B口0FFFDH,控制口0FFFEH)。(3)初始化程序(假设系统为8086,使用汇编):MOVDX,0FFFEH;控制端口地址MOVAL,10000010B;方式控制字:A口方式0输出,B口方式0输入,C口未

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论